## Runbook: Zero-Downtime Schema Migrations — Orchard DB

New team members: all migrations on the Orchard cluster follow the expand–migrate–contract pattern. First add new columns as nullable, then backfill in batches of 10k rows via the Tillage job runner, and only drop old columns after two full release cycles. Never run a contract step during business hours for the Westvale region. Backfill jobs must authenticate to the internal Tillage scheduler before they will enqueue; use the key below.

API key for fahip-kahip: zpat23_XiJGUHz5xfaAtaIqUkus0rh

Ticket: Drift detected on the Furrowlink telemetry gateway. The staging fleet in the Dunmere test paddock reports a different batching interval and retry ceiling than what the repo defines, which explains the duplicate sensor frames reviewers flagged in last week's diff. Before merging the reconciliation patch, please verify the change set against what is actually deployed. The gateway's current running configuration follows below.

deployment values, yadug-bawif:
[framir]
team = pelox
access_code = ac_a38ab2
owner = tamion.julael
host = framir.tolvaqlabs.test
port = 11211
peer = tammir.zemvargrid.local
salt = 2215ef03
pin = 1541

The pallet of recalled Voltery QuickCell chargers was not collected from the Brindlehurst receiving dock as scheduled Tuesday; the carrier logged a site-access issue. The pallet remains shrink-wrapped, quarantine-tagged, and stored away from outbound stock per the recall notice. A re-attempt is booked for Thursday between 09:00 and 11:00. Receiving must verify the carton count against the recall manifest before release. The courier collecting the pallet must be given this instruction verbatim.

dispatch memo: the lamwyn fenwyn courier leaves the wenir ledger at gate 7175 under passcode 822969